UNIQUE LETTER TO SIR JOSEPH BANKS (INC. HIS MS DRAFT REPLY) CONCERNING THE UNEXPLAINED LEVITATION OF A CAT: 24 July 1789 EL (reinforced on centrefold with archival tape) from Mayfair to Joseph Banks in Soho Square (naturalist & botanist instrumental in numerous worldwide expeditions & the cultivation of exotic specimens in Kew Gardens) with fine "W" Westminster Office "SA" Dockwra & fair L368 time stamp on the reverse. Detailed description within (witnessed by the author & his sister) of a panting cat leaping from a chair and in mid-air: "her body became more & more light, swelled, and distorted, and she then, gradually & perpendicularly arose in a walking posture to the height of nine or ten feet from the floor, where after being suspended for a few seconds, she descended...". Includes a draft of Banks' brisque reply in his own hand. Cross Reference: AUTOGRAPHS
